Trupeer was founded in 2023 by Shivali Goyal and Pritish Gupta, both veterans with impressive backgrounds—Goyal having led digital transformation projects at Boston Consulting Group and Gupta bringing experience from hypergrowth startups and leadership roles. They identified a recurring challenge faced by software teams: creating high-quality product videos and documentation was tedious, costly, and time-consuming. Inspired to solve this problem, they launched Trupeer to democratize video content creation, enabling anyone to easily produce crisp tutorials and walkthroughs without professional editing skills.
At its heart, Trupeer operates through a sophisticated multimodal AI pipeline that seamlessly combines voice recognition, transcription, speech and humanlike avatar generation, and large language models (LLMs). Users simply record their screen using the Trupeer Chrome extension while narrating their process. The AI then automatically removes filler words, adds professional-quality voiceovers (in 100+ voices and accents), includes zoom transitions based on clicks, generates subtitles, and offers customizable backgrounds and music. Additionally, it creates step-by-step documentation with screenshots and summaries, making videos and manuals accessible and comprehensive.
Trupeer’s user interface is designed for simplicity and speed, requiring no videography or editing expertise. After recording, users can modify the auto-generated script, select AI voices, adjust branding elements like logos and colors, and then export content in various formats including MP4 video, PDF, Word, and Markdown documents. In July 2025, Trupeer raised $3 million in a seed funding round led by RTP Global, with significant participation from Salesforce Ventures and a consortium of more than 20 CIOs and CTOs from Fortune 500 companies. This financing reflects strong investor confidence in Trupeer's AI-powered approach. Salesforce’s involvement came after Trupeer won Salesforce’s AI Pitchfield competition, underscoring its innovation and market potential. The capital is earmarked for product development, global go-to-market expansion, and advancing AI capabilities.
Trupeer operates in a competitive field with players like Loom, InVideo, and Vidyard also offering video creation tools. However, Trupeer distinguishes itself through deep AI integration that goes beyond screen recording to generate highly contextual, branded, and multilingual content automatically. Its proprietary synchronization engine aligns voiceovers and video frames with near-zero manual editing. This capability, combined with a fast video rendering engine, provides speed and quality advantages over conventional tools.
